Crash reports from the Pebblefern mobile app upload on next launch, get symbolicated by the Ashgrove worker, and land in the support queue grouped by stack signature. Duplicate groups collapse automatically; only new signatures page anyone. Support sees the symbolicated trace plus device metadata, nothing raw. Ingestion throttles and grouping thresholds are fixed per release and listed here.

tuning table, yajog-yahof:
BUDGETS = {
    "lamvan": 303,
    "wenox": 460,
    "fenvan": 525,
}

## Tuning

The Skellerby relay logs every hop, which floods storage at peak. Sampling is applied at ingest, before the Dunmow sink, and is keyed on trace ID so kept traces stay complete. Error and fatal lines always pass. Raising the sample rate increases storage cost roughly linearly; lowering it degrades trace coverage for the debug tooling, so change both ends together. Restart the relay after edits — values are read once at boot, not hot-reloaded. Defaults shipped with the current release are listed below.

tuning table, hafog-bahaf:
QUOTAS = {
    "praion": 144,
    "briax": 906,
    "silwyn": 451,
}

**09:47 — Thumbnail queue saturation begins.** The Snapmill resizing workers fell behind after a burst of oversized uploads from the Ferngate migration. Backlog grew to 38,000 jobs before autoscaling engaged at 10:05, delayed because the scaling signal watched CPU rather than queue depth. Future maintainers should note this gap persisted until the 10:20 hotfix, which rebalanced shard weights and added a depth-based trigger. For audit purposes, the worker build that contained the hotfix is recorded below.

pipeline stamp: htk9_6ce9d33c5

CI note: if the admin-table bulk-edit tests flake on the Pinloft suite, it's almost always the seeded fixture race — the bulk update fires before all 200 rows land. Bump the seed-wait helper rather than adding sleeps, please. Also, the "select all" checkbox only selects the visible page, which trips people up constantly. The last known-good run that exercises the full bulk path is tagged with the token below.

trace token, fafog-kageg: htk4_98e6